Adam Jones recognized him; he was Elly Campbell’s cousin, Mark Campbell, the son of Harry Campbell, six years younger than Elly, just starting his sophomore year in college.

Aside from the Old Master of the Campbell Family, no one knew that the marriage between Elly Campbell and Adam Jones existed in name only, especially the family of Harry Campbell, who had settled down in the United States early on, which is why Mark had asked that question.

When Mark mentioned Elly, Adam’s gaze darkened slightly and he responded indifferently, "I don’t know."

Despite saying that, his eyes involuntarily shifted towards the Campbell Family’s front gate and his eyebrows subtly furrowed.

The smile on Mark’s face stiffened, and seeing Adam’s slightly somber expression, it seemed he realized something and lowered his voice to ask, "Did you have an argument with my sister?"

Adam tensed up and kept his eyes down without speaking.

"My sister has that temper; brother-in-law, please be more patient. Between husband and wife, disputes at the head of the bed lead to resolutions at the foot. When my sister comes later, I’ll speak on your behalf."
